1. Joints Work Like a Machine

Our bodies are like a finely tuned machine with all the bones and joints working together to give us locomotion. Bones provide the structure of our body while the joints act as the hinges, allowing our limbs and joints to move in various directions. Without bones and joints, we would be little more than a blob of limp flesh! That’s why it’s important to take good care of our bones and joints, so that they can provide us with the mobility required for daily life.

2. Move It or Lose It

This old adage is especially true when it comes to our bones and joints. Keeping them active by exercising regularly helps keep them strong, healthy, and flexible; whereas if we don’t use them, they can become weak and stiff over time. So whether you’re going for a run or just taking a walk around your neighborhood, make sure to keep your bones and joints moving!

3. Don’t Skip Leg Day

While it’s tempting to focus on upper body exercises when working out, leg day is just as important! Your legs are made up of numerous bones and joint structures that support your weight during everyday activities like walking or running, so make sure you take time to strengthen those lower body muscles too!

4. Be Mindful When Lifting

It’s easy to get caught up in the excitement of lifting heavier weights at the gym, but it’s important not to push yourself too hard – especially when it comes to protecting your bones and joints. When lifting weights or performing other exercises that involve your limbs or back, make sure you use proper form so that you don’t strain any part of your body unnecessarily.

5. Ice Is Nice For Injuries

If you ever find yourself with an injured bone or joint due to overexertion or an accident, ice can be one of the best treatments for reducing inflammation and pain. Applying ice regularly throughout the day can help reduce swelling while also providing some relief from discomfort – just make sure not to apply it directly on your skin!

6. Stretch It Out Before Exercise

Stretching is an essential part of any exercise routine – not only does it prepare your muscles for physical activity but also prepares your bones and joints for movement by loosening them up beforehand. Make sure you properly stretch out each muscle group before starting any exercise routine as this will help reduce any potential injuries down the road.

7. Keep Your Bones Healthy With Calcium

Our bones need calcium in order for them remain strong and healthy; without adequate amounts of calcium in our diets, our bones can become weak over time which could lead to fractures or even osteoporosis later on in life. Make sure you consume enough calcium-rich foods such as dairy products or green leafy vegetables in order maintain optimal bone health.

8. Take Breaks From Repetitive Activities

If you’re doing activities that involve repetitive movements such as typing on a computer keyboard all day long at work, then it’s important that you take regular breaks throughout the day in order to rest your bones and joints from any strain they might be under during prolonged periods of use. Taking short breaks every hour or so will help relieve tension from tired muscles.

9 . Get Regular Checkups
It’s always a good idea to get regular checkups with your doctor if you have any concerns about potential problems with your bones or joints; this way they can assess how well everything is functioning together before anything serious happens . Orthopedic Surgery: An Overview

Orthopedic surgery is a type of medical procedure that is used to repair and restore the functions of the musculoskeletal system. This includes bones, joints, ligaments, tendons, muscles, and other connective tissues. Orthopedic surgery is typically used to correct deformities, correct joint pain or stiffness, repair broken bones, or improve mobility. In some cases orthopedic surgery can also be used to prevent further damage or deterioration of the musculoskeletal system.

Benefits of Orthopedic Surgery

Orthopedic surgery can provide a variety of benefits for patients. These benefits include improved mobility, reduced pain and discomfort, improved range of motion, improved posture and balance, and improved overall quality of life. Orthopedic surgery can also help prevent further damage or deterioration of the musculoskeletal system by correcting abnormalities before they become more serious conditions.
